A flaw was found in libsoup. After a CONNECT tunnel is established through an HTTP proxy, libsoup incorrectly attaches the Proxy-Authorization header to subsequent HTTPS requests sent through that tunnel to the destination server. This allows the destination server to capture proxy credentials, leading to information disclosure.
A flaw was found in libsoup. The chunked transfer encoding parser uses a permissive parsing function for chunk sizes that silently accepts inputs violating RFC 9112, including leading whitespace, plus sign prefixes, and trailing invalid characters. When libsoup operates behind a strict frontend proxy, this parsing differential can be exploited to smuggle HTTP requests.
A flaw was found in libsoup. An unsigned integer underflow in the soup_filter_input_stream_read_until() function causes a heap buffer over-read when parsing multipart HTTP responses. A malicious HTTP server can exploit this by sending a crafted multipart response, potentially causing the client application to crash or disclose sensitive heap memory.
